'Fonce' and Mabel Martinez to celebrate 50 years together Mr. and Mrs. Alfonzo Martinez Mar-tinez will be celebrating their 50th anniversary on Sunday, Nov. 20. "Fonce" and Mabel, now residents of Heber City, were married Nov. 25, 1933 in Heber City. Fonce was born April 7, 1915 in Salt Lake City to Joseph and Beneta Martinez. Mar-tinez. He spent his childhood in Park City. Mabel was born April 11, 1917 in Heber City to Andrew and Myrtle Mair. Mable grew up in Heber City. Fonce and Mabel lived most of their married life in Park City where Fonce worked in various positions in the mines. He retired from United Park Mines in 1976. Mabel worked 41 years at various jobs including 13 years with the Park City School District, from which she retired in 1982. Richard and Leona Martinez, Mar-tinez, son and daughter-in-law, along with Fonce and Mabel's nine grandchildren and 13 great grandchildren will be hosting an open house in their honor.
